About Chris Francis

Chris Francis serves as the Senior Vice President of Corporate Development and Head of Emerging Areas at Wave Life Sciences, where he has worked since 2016. He has extensive experience in business development and scientific licensing, having held key positions at GSK and Wave Life Sciences, and has a strong academic background in biochemistry and biophysics.

Current Role at Wave Life Sciences

Chris Francis serves as the Senior Vice President of Corporate Development and Head of Emerging Areas at Wave Life Sciences. He has held this position since 2016, contributing to the company's strategic direction and growth in the Greater Boston Area. In his current role, he manages investments in enabling technologies and leads the formation of strategic collaborations with major pharmaceutical companies, including Takeda, GSK, and Pfizer. His involvement in partnership steering committees reflects his integral role within the executive team.

Previous Experience at Wave Life Sciences

Prior to his current position, Chris Francis worked at Wave Life Sciences as Vice President of Business Development from 2014 to 2016. During his tenure, he focused on developing business strategies and fostering partnerships that aligned with the company’s objectives. His experience in this role laid the groundwork for his subsequent leadership in corporate development.

Career at GSK

Chris Francis held multiple roles at GSK from 2009 to 2014. He served as Director of Academic Licensing and Strategic Alliances for ten months before transitioning to Director of Scientific Operations for one year. He then became Director of Scientific Licensing, a position he held for three years. His work involved overseeing scientific collaborations and licensing agreements, which contributed to GSK's strategic initiatives in the pharmaceutical sector.

Educational Background

Chris Francis earned his Bachelor of Science in Biochemistry and Molecular Biology from the University of Melbourne, completing his studies from 1998 to 2001. He further pursued advanced studies at the same institution, achieving a PhD in Biophysics from 2002 to 2007. Additionally, he was a Research Associate at the University of Cambridge from 2003 to 2005, where he focused on biophysics research.

Early Career Experience

Before his roles in corporate development and scientific licensing, Chris Francis began his career at IMS Consulting Group as an Analyst in Pricing and Reimbursement from 2005 to 2007. He also worked as an Associate at Two River from 2008 to 2009 and held a summer position as a Scientific Programmer at VPAC in 2002. These early experiences provided him with a foundation in analysis and strategic planning within the life sciences sector.
